CWU volleyball beats Western Oregon in five games

  • September 23, 2014

Kiah Jones had 20 kills to help lead Central Washington past Western Oregon 3-2 on Monday in the New PE Building.

The Wildcats won 24-26, 25-18, 25-21, 19-25, 15-10 to improve to 2-1 in the GNAC and 9-2 overall. Western Oregon fell to 0-4 and 2-10.

Catie Fry had 58 assists and 17 digs, while Kaely Kight had 32 digs for Central Washington.

The Wildcats return to Ellensburg for a home match against Alaska on Thursday at 7 p.m.
